Explanation:
The volume of the hot water in the hemispherical bowl = 2πr3/3
Given that Radius of the hemispherical bowl and that of the cylindrical vessel is the same.
Also, radius is 50% more than its height.
Thus, h = 2r/3
Thus, the volume of the cylindrical vessel = 2πr3/3
Hence, the volume of the hot water in the cylindrical vessel is 100% of the cylindrical vessel.
Hence, option C is the correct answer.
